Goal setting is a powerful tool for enhancing motivation and performance, as it provides clear direction and measurable outcomes. Effective goals are spec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ART), which helps individuals maintain focus and track progress. Additionally, setting goals can boost self-efficacy and commitment, leading to greater persistence in pursuing objectives. Overall, well-defined goals can significantly improve personal and professional growth.

What is the difference between planning and programming?

Planning involves the analysis of conditions, setting goals, and developing methods of reaching those goals. Programming, in most cases, relates to the development of an actual program of projects and policies to reach that goal. In a business case, this generally involves setting a budget to undertake projects that move the business toward its goal.

What is the most accurate clock you can buy?

Atomic clocks are the most accurate clocks that are available to the general public. To date, the most accurate clock made is the so-called quantum logic clock, which is accurate to about one second in 3.7 billion years.
